Output e5bebf06333d78e00ae0fcda2704a1112616b6a6e5b826de1b264e19cb05bbac:12

value
59049
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 803f7ed6d51e8a2a7530e7ba8f40abc134bb4b3ffd9860533f08cc5dc4c4cae7
address
bc1psqlha4k4r69z5afsu7ag7s9tcy6tkjellkvxq5elprx9m3xyetnshdpgys
transaction
e5bebf06333d78e00ae0fcda2704a1112616b6a6e5b826de1b264e19cb05bbac
confirmations
20473
spent
true